Prim’s algorithm is a type of minimum spanning tree algorithm that works on the graph and finds the subset of the edges of that graph having the minimum sum of weights in all the tress that can be possibly built from that graph with all the vertex forms a tree.. Distance Vector Routing Algorithm Example. Important Note: This algorithm is based on the greedy approach. Please Improve this article if you find anything incorrect by clicking on the "Improve Article" button below. After we pick an edge, we mark both vertices as included in MST. Last Updated: 31-10-2019 We have discussed Prim’s algorithm and its implementation for adjacency matrix representation of graphs. We make a vector of pairs(adj_lis)Â to represent the graph. Before we get started with the algorithm, let’s look at the tools we would be needing – Priority Queue – We will be using a Binary Min-Heap with an array-based implementation with a small twist. We enter the neighboring edges of the node in the priority queue(min-heap) and extract the one with the minimum weight. Using an algorithm, shortest distance between the cities is measured. MST stands for a minimum spanning tree. The minimum spanning tree MST of an undirected graph G is a subgraph that is a tree which includes all of the vertices of G, with a minimum total sum of weights of edges. edit Note that time complexity of previous approach that uses adjacency matrix is O(V2) and time complexity of the adjacency list representation implementation is O((E+V)LogV). prims algorithm program in cpp; prims algorithm python geeksforgeeks; prims algorithm values; minimum spanning tree prim's algorithm code; prim mst is a dynamic programming; prim mst uses; write prim's algorithm for adjacenecy list; prim's algorithm using greedy method example; prims algorithm using dynamic programming; graph prim algorithm In prims algorithm, we start from any node, then we check the adjacent nodes weight. Prim’s algorithm using priority_queue in STL Last Updated: 15-07-2018 Given an undirected, connected and weighted graph, find Minimum Spanning Tree (MST) of the graph using Prim’s algorithm. This image is a part of a set of featured pictures, which means that members of the community have identified it as part of a related set of the finest images on the English Wikipedia. For this sample C++ assignment, the expert is demonstrating to students the implemention of Prim’s algorithm to find a minimum spanning tree. The Prim’s algorithm function uses C++ reference parameters to yield the necessary results. Prim’s Algorithm. We have to implement prim's algorithm using 2 maps(string, Vertex(class) and string,vector). // STL implementation of Prim's algorithm for MST #include

